Position Summary:
The Corporate Senior Accountant is responsible for assisting with the month end close process and ensuring transactions are recorded in the proper period. The Corporate Senior Accountant is also a resource for the other members of the corporate accounting team to assist with challenging accounting tasks. The position requires interfacing with various departments in the Company to provide and receive information pertinent to various accounting issues.
Essential Functions:
Financial Objectives
Work in a manner that meets budgeted costs and constraints of the accounting department.
Assist in measuring Company’s performance toward achieving its goals.
Operational/Functional Objectives
Actively participate in the planning and execution of the month end close process and search for continuous improvement in processes and quality and timeliness of work.
Help create and maintain all methods, models and workflows necessary to ensure shared expenses are properly allocated among entities based on established metrics.
Completes required account reconciliations and expense analysis.
Review preliminary statements and investigate unusual fluctuations and unexpected activity.
Assist in the preparation of monthly internal management reports.
Maintain and improve reporting as needed to meet management requests.
Work with accounting manager to respond to requests from external auditors including completing support schedules and providing detail as requested.
Draft and update accounting policies, procedures, practices and guidelines as requested by management focusing on ways to improve processes through automation.
Conduct special projects and other services at the request of management, which includes financial analysis and accounting
Qualifications:
Bachelor’s degree from a four-year college or university, with an accounting or finance major.
3 to 5 years related accounting experience preferred.
CPA is a plus.
Must be proficient in various software packages including, but not limited to, MS Word, MS Excel, MS Office. Strong Excel proficiency such as pivot tables, lookups and formula creation required.
Must be experienced in use of accounting enterprise software. Yardi experience a plus.
Property Management experience a plus.
Able to use data from different sources to identify issues and quickly identify the central or underlying issues in a complex situation.
Excellent verbal and written communication, organizational and presentation skills. Proven self-starter with ability to work independently.
Reliable, dependable, and trustworthy.
Performs duties in a professional manner and in accordance with laws and regulations

Corporate Accountant Jobs in Arizona: Frequently Asked Questions
How do you become a corporate accountant in Arizona?
A bachelor's degree in accounting or a related field is the baseline for corporate accountant roles in Arizona. Most employers expect candidates to hold or be actively pursuing a CPA license, which in Arizona is issued by the Arizona State Board of Accountancy. The Board requires completing the Uniform CPA Exam and meeting the education and experience thresholds before licensure. Some employers accept candidates without a CPA if they have substantial corporate finance experience.
How much do corporate accountants make in Arizona?
Corporate accountants in Arizona earn a median of about $79,970 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$55,430 for the lowest 10% to over $128,890 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.

How can I get hired as a corporate accountant in Arizona with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path is applying for staff accountant or accounting associate roles at Arizona-based employers such as Banner Health, Arizona Public Service, or large regional public accounting firms that rotate staff into corporate clients. These organizations run structured new-graduate programs that funnel early-career candidates into core accounting functions. A completed or in-progress CPA Exam gives applicants a measurable edge, and lateral moves from accounts payable, accounts receivable, or financial analyst positions at the same employer are a common route into a corporate accountant title.
